Notes

General note

Each work has separate t.p.

The Ballantyne-humbug handled, in a letter to Sir Adam Fergusson: 2nd ed. ; Edinburgh : Robert Cadell ; London : John Murray, and Whittaker & Co. 1839.

Bound with Lockhart's Ballantyne-humbug handled; Reply to Mr. Lockhart's pamphlet, entitled, "The Ballantyne-Humbug handled" and appendix.

Mitchell Library copy signed, 'D.S. Mitchell' ; has bookseller's label: "John Smith & Son" ; signed, 'John A.? Ballantyne from ... Constable' ; signed, 'Marmaduke Constable July 1844'....
